Aplicaciones

Implementación de SSL en WordPress

SSL (Secure Sockets Layer) y HTTPS (Hypertext Transfer Protocol Secure) son protocolos fundamentales para garantizar la seguridad y privacidad de las comunicaciones en línea. En el contexto de WordPress, la implementación de SSL y HTTPS es esencial para proteger la información sensible de los usuarios, como contraseñas, datos de pago y otra información personal.

Para utilizar SSL y HTTPS con WordPress, hay varios pasos que se deben seguir:

  1. Obtener un certificado SSL: El primer paso es adquirir un certificado SSL. Este certificado es emitido por una Autoridad de Certificación (CA) y sirve para cifrar las comunicaciones entre el servidor web y el navegador del usuario. Puedes obtener un certificado SSL de forma gratuita a través de servicios como Let’s Encrypt, o adquirirlo a través de un proveedor de servicios de hosting.

  2. Instalar y configurar el certificado SSL en el servidor: Una vez que hayas obtenido el certificado SSL, debes instalarlo y configurarlo en tu servidor web. La forma de hacerlo puede variar dependiendo del proveedor de hosting que utilices. Algunos proveedores ofrecen herramientas automatizadas para facilitar este proceso, mientras que en otros casos puede ser necesario configurarlo manualmente.

  3. Actualizar la configuración de WordPress: Después de instalar el certificado SSL en el servidor, es importante actualizar la configuración de WordPress para que utilice HTTPS en lugar de HTTP. Para hacer esto, puedes modificar la configuración en el panel de administración de WordPress o mediante la edición del archivo wp-config.php. Además, es recomendable actualizar los enlaces internos y cualquier contenido incrustado (como imágenes, scripts, etc.) para que utilicen URLs con HTTPS en lugar de HTTP.

  4. Redireccionamiento de HTTP a HTTPS: Es crucial configurar redireccionamientos para que todas las solicitudes HTTP sean redirigidas automáticamente a HTTPS. Esto garantiza que los usuarios siempre se conecten de forma segura a tu sitio web, incluso si intentan acceder a él a través de HTTP. Puedes configurar redireccionamientos a nivel de servidor utilizando archivos de configuración como .htaccess en servidores Apache, o a través de la configuración del servidor en el caso de servidores Nginx.

  5. Verificación y pruebas: Una vez que hayas configurado SSL y HTTPS en tu sitio de WordPress, es importante realizar pruebas exhaustivas para asegurarte de que todo funciona correctamente. Debes verificar que el certificado SSL esté instalado correctamente, que no haya errores de redireccionamiento y que todas las páginas se carguen correctamente a través de HTTPS. También puedes utilizar herramientas en línea como SSL Labs para realizar pruebas de seguridad y evaluar la configuración SSL de tu sitio.

  6. Mantenimiento continuo: Una vez que hayas implementado SSL y HTTPS en tu sitio de WordPress, es importante mantenerlo actualizado y monitorear regularmente su seguridad. Debes estar atento a posibles problemas como la expiración del certificado SSL, errores de configuración o vulnerabilidades de seguridad. Además, es recomendable configurar alertas para recibir notificaciones en caso de cualquier problema relacionado con SSL o HTTPS.

En resumen, utilizar SSL y HTTPS con WordPress es fundamental para garantizar la seguridad y privacidad de tu sitio web. Siguiendo los pasos mencionados anteriormente, puedes implementar SSL de manera efectiva y asegurarte de que tus usuarios se conecten de forma segura a tu sitio de WordPress.

Más Informaciones

Por supuesto, profundicemos más en cada uno de los pasos para utilizar SSL y HTTPS con WordPress:

  1. Obtener un certificado SSL:

    • Como se mencionó anteriormente, un certificado SSL es necesario para establecer una conexión segura entre el servidor web y el navegador del usuario. Puedes obtener un certificado SSL de diferentes maneras:
      • Proveedores de servicios de hosting: Muchos proveedores de hosting ofrecen certificados SSL gratuitos o de pago como parte de sus paquetes de servicios. Algunos incluso proporcionan integraciones automáticas con servicios como Let’s Encrypt, que ofrece certificados SSL gratuitos y renovables.
      • Autoridades de Certificación (CA): También puedes obtener certificados SSL directamente de autoridades de certificación como Sectigo, DigiCert, GeoTrust, entre otros. Estos certificados suelen ser de pago y ofrecen una variedad de opciones y características adicionales.
  2. Instalar y configurar el certificado SSL en el servidor:

    • Una vez que hayas obtenido el certificado SSL, debes instalarlo y configurarlo en tu servidor web. Los pasos exactos para hacer esto pueden variar según el proveedor de hosting y el tipo de servidor que estés utilizando (por ejemplo, Apache, Nginx, IIS).
    • Algunos proveedores de hosting ofrecen herramientas automáticas para instalar y configurar certificados SSL, lo que facilita el proceso para los usuarios sin experiencia técnica.
    • Es importante asegurarse de que el certificado SSL esté correctamente instalado y configurado para que funcione correctamente en todas las páginas y subdominios de tu sitio web.
  3. Actualizar la configuración de WordPress:

    • Una vez que el certificado SSL esté instalado en el servidor, debes actualizar la configuración de WordPress para utilizar HTTPS en lugar de HTTP. Esto se puede hacer modificando la configuración en el panel de administración de WordPress o mediante la edición del archivo wp-config.php.
    • Además de actualizar la configuración, es importante actualizar todos los enlaces internos y recursos incrustados (como imágenes, scripts, hojas de estilo) para que utilicen URLs con HTTPS en lugar de HTTP. Esto garantiza que todas las páginas se carguen de forma segura y que no haya contenido mixto (es decir, contenido que se carga a través de HTTP en una página HTTPS).
  4. Redireccionamiento de HTTP a HTTPS:

    • Configurar redireccionamientos para que todas las solicitudes HTTP sean redirigidas automáticamente a HTTPS es fundamental para garantizar que los usuarios siempre se conecten de forma segura a tu sitio web.
    • Esto se puede hacer a nivel de servidor utilizando archivos de configuración como .htaccess en servidores Apache, o mediante la configuración del servidor en el caso de servidores Nginx.
    • Los redireccionamientos deben ser configurados de manera adecuada para evitar bucles de redireccionamiento y garantizar un funcionamiento óptimo del sitio web.
  5. Verificación y pruebas:

    • Después de implementar SSL y HTTPS en tu sitio de WordPress, es importante realizar pruebas exhaustivas para asegurarte de que todo funciona correctamente.
    • Debes verificar que el certificado SSL esté instalado correctamente y que no haya errores de configuración.
    • También es importante realizar pruebas de carga y rendimiento para asegurarte de que el sitio web se carga de manera eficiente a través de HTTPS.
    • Herramientas como SSL Labs, GTmetrix y Google PageSpeed Insights pueden ser útiles para realizar pruebas de seguridad y rendimiento.
  6. Mantenimiento continuo:

    • Una vez que hayas implementado SSL y HTTPS en tu sitio de WordPress, es importante realizar un mantenimiento continuo para garantizar la seguridad y el buen funcionamiento del sitio.
    • Debes estar atento a posibles problemas como la expiración del certificado SSL, errores de configuración o vulnerabilidades de seguridad.
    • Además, es recomendable configurar alertas para recibir notificaciones en caso de cualquier problema relacionado con SSL o HTTPS.
    • También es importante mantener actualizado tanto WordPress como los complementos y temas instalados en el sitio, ya que las actualizaciones pueden incluir mejoras de seguridad y compatibilidad con HTTPS.

En resumen, la implementación de SSL y HTTPS en WordPress es un proceso fundamental para garantizar la seguridad y privacidad de tu sitio web. Siguiendo estos pasos y realizando un mantenimiento continuo, puedes asegurarte de que tu sitio de WordPress esté protegido y funcione de manera óptima en todo momento.

Botón volver arriba